Artificial Neural Network Model for Prediction of Childhood Allergic Asthma Using Single Nucleotide Polymorphism Data

Screening of various gene markers (e.g., microsatellite polymorphisms, variable number of tandem repeats, single nucleotide polymorphism (SNP)) and correlation between these markers and pathogenesis of allergic disease have been studied. However, there have been no proposed prediction models with high accuracy using such factors. In order to predict development of disease, we applied a knowledge processing method based on an artificial neural network (ANN) model to diagnostic prediction of 172 subjects with childhood allergic asthma (CAA) and 172 healthy subjects, using 25 SNPs in 17 genes. SNP data was kindly provided by the ethics committees of Tohoku University and RIKEN. For comparison with ANN, we also used logistic regression (LR) analysis, which is currently used to analyze medical statistics. In order to selectively identify causal SNPs, a parameter decreasing method (PDM) was used in the ANN modeling. Associations between combinations of significant SNPs and CAA pathogenesis were investigated. We found that the ANN was able to represent associations between CAA and 2 or 3-SNP combinations using complicated nonlinear relations. Thus, the ANN can be used to characterize development of complex diseases caused by multiple factors.
